Handing off Pickforge to you. Optimizer core is stable; the zone-batching heuristic is the risky part, flagged in review comments. Tests pass but the congestion model is undertested — don't trust it near aisle caps. Deploy script is manual for now. Full context, open questions, and the deploy checklist live on the internal page below.

dashboard of bafof-hafog = https://confluence.lumiclabs.internal/display/browse/display/6a09a20a

# Break-Glass: Catalog Cache Invalidation

Scope: the Pinrow product catalog at Veldstone Retail. If stale prices persist after a purge and the Hollowmere invalidation queue is wedged, use break-glass to flush the edge tier directly. Contractors: get verbal sign-off from the catalog lead first. Steps: open the Hollowmere admin shell, select emergency-flush, confirm the tenant, and run it once — repeated flushes thrash the origin. Access is logged and expires after 20 minutes. Unseal the admin shell with the passphrase below.

recovery phrase for kahop-tajog: istix-casvan

## Build Provenance: Tax-Rate Lookup Cache (Ledgermoth)

The Ledgermoth tax-rate cache is baked into each release artifact at build time from the regional rate tables. New team members: never edit the cache in a running environment; rate corrections must go through a rebuild so provenance stays intact. Each artifact records the rate-table snapshot date alongside its build metadata. The snapshot currently in production corresponds to the token below.

session token of tajef-bageg = htk21_5d90d574934f3ccae6437

Contacts: Proctorline exam queue

The Proctorline queue assigns invigilators to live exam sessions. For queue stalls or stuck assignments, the Sessions team owns the dispatcher; the Ledgewick platform team owns the underlying broker. Release freezes during exam windows are mandatory. Before cutting any release touching the dispatcher, confirm the freeze calendar with the team at the address below.

alerts address for bawif-hahig: norwyn_gorys_lamath@olvarqlabs.test